User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.0; en-US; rv:1.3a) Gecko/20021212 Build Identifier: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.0; en-US; rv:1.3a) Gecko/20021212 Looking at an email with ALL headers shown, only one received header is listed. When saved to a .eml file and then viewing raw with text viewer I can see all headers, in this case there are 5 received headers. It appears the first received header isthe one that is shown, that would be the first chronologically, or the last in the actually header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Receive email 2. View headers->All Actual Results: Only 1 received header was shown Expected Results: Show all received headers
This is a duplicate of bug 49305. Fixed on or about 2nd Jan 2003.
